    Trade Scams.
    Let's have this one for example:
    Scammer: I'll buy your vanity for 90,000g.
    Victim: Alright, that sounds good.
    Scammer then places the 90k for the vanity but repeatedly cancels it due to lag, confirmation button, or accuses the victim of cancelling. About the third or fourth time the scammer continues to do that the victim is just desperate to finish the trade and does not notice the 90k has magically turned into 9k. That would be considered a trade scam. It has happened to many players before, including myself, so people should take BIG precautions when trading something of high value or anything for that matter. Please make sure that what the buyer/seller placed the said item in the trade window since that is why the double confirmation button is in place.

    scammer calls out: trade lep for soandso weapon of effectiveness, lv xx.
    you find said weapon in auction for 95k.
    buy the weapon, trade for lep and you got a lep for 95k right?
    no, he puts lep in trade window, sees the weapon you bought (from some other ign, his or his pal) and cancels trade, runs away, collects his gold from CS.
    you have soandso weapon of effectiveness, lv xx which is worth exactly nothing, he has 95k.

    i call out this scam every time i see it happening.

    if its too good to be true, its a lie. run away.

    By all your posts i also remember a new type of scam which i encountered many times in paradise pier. A person say of selling steel commando vest and when u ask price he will say a low price however not too low so that the victim detects something fishy bt arnd 300-400k less and of course people will wanna buy that and will be very excited of nice deal. Ok then at trade scammer puts vest and at second confirmation leaves then he says wait got another offer or gotta check auction(or something like that) and the victim will freak out of losing the deal and will want to complete deal fast and next time trading scammer put steel helm instead of vest which is very low value than vest and in excitement victim may complete trade. I have been tried to scam like this 2 times but both times I was alert thank god . I think this also will come under trade scam
